i have a 2001 grand am gt. am looking at installing a viper 5901. what do i all need to install this. i currently have a astrostart remote starter in my car but am just going to take that thing out. am thinking of getting the xk01 but am not totally sure what that all does. if i get that will i only have to wire up the remote starter part. should i even bother getting a expresskit, since all the wires should be going to the remote starter i already have. thanks.
if there is an existing starter in the car, no need for any additional bypasses or modules. just trace the wire back, test to make sure and connect and solder your new wires.
